The Disdain of Healthcare Executives

This chapter critically examines the pervasive public anger towards health insurance executives in the U.S. and the complexities of the healthcare system that fuels this resentment. It discusses the themes of human disposability and the emotional toll of bureaucratic obstacles faced by patients and their families. Additionally, it explores how societal perceptions of violence, suffering, and accountability intertwine with personal experiences and cultural narratives.
